Popular Welder’s Qualifications
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s regular CW (Certified Welder) certificate helps make you eligible for the majority of employment opportunities, many industries demand their certain certification. Several of the most-common of them appear below.
- CWI and SCWI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for those who work on pipelines in the oil and gas field
- Certified Welder Certificates to become a Certified Welder
- ASME Certification for welders who focus on boiler and pressure containers

Employment and Salary
Welder Jobs and Growth Projections for Minnesota
We don’t have to tell you the need for welders in the State of Minnesota continues to grow each year per O*Net Online. With an anticipated average growth in new welding specialist jobs to grow very fast annually until 2022, the significant rate of growth is significantly above the nation’s mean for all jobs. Considering the variety of positive variables to help you, your opportunity will never be better to become a welding specialist.
The subsequent data features wage and employment estimates for welding professionals in Minnesota through the end of the decade.
| Minnesota |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 8,170 | 8,710 | 7% | 250 |
| Minnesota |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$27,000 | $38,800 | $55,500 |
Source: O*Net Online
What You Should Consider When Choosing Welding Specialist Training in Belgrade, MN
There are several matters you need to consider when you’re prepared to choose between welding schools. Once you get started looking, you’ll find tons of training programs, but what exactly do you have to try to look for when selecting welding specialist schools? Official recognition by the AWS is one of the most vital factor that can allow you to find the ideal courses. While not as vital as the accreditation status, you may want to take a look at several of the following parts also:
- Try to find classes that cover AWS SENSE standards
- Be certain the institution trains with gear that suits present trade guidelines
- Find out if the program provides financial support
- Make sure the school’s curriculum features classes in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
